x86/efi-bgrt: Replace early_memremap() with memremap()
commit e2c90dd7e11e3025b46719a79fb4bb1e7a5cef9f upstream. Môshe reported the following warning triggered on his machine since commit 50a0cb565246 ("x86/efi-bgrt: Fix kernel panic when mapping BGRT data"), [ 0.026936] ------------[ cut here ]------------ [ 0.026941] WARNING: CPU: 0 PID: 0 at mm/early_ioremap.c:137 __early_ioremap+0x102/0x1bb() [ 0.026941] Modules linked in: [ 0.026944] CPU: 0 PID: 0 Comm: swapper/0 Not tainted 4.4.0-rc1 #2 [ 0.026945] Hardware name: Dell Inc. XPS 13 9343/09K8G1, BIOS A05 07/14/2015 [ 0.026946] 0000000000000000 900f03d5a116524d ffffffff81c03e60 ffffffff813a3fff [ 0.026948] 0000000000000000 ffffffff81c03e98 ffffffff810a0852 00000000d7b76000 [ 0.026949] 0000000000000000 0000000000000001 0000000000000001 000000000000017c [ 0.026951] Call Trace: [ 0.026955] [<ffffffff813a3fff>] dump_stack+0x44/0x55 [ 0.026958] [<ffffffff810a0852>] warn_slowpath_common+0x82/0xc0 [ 0.026959] [<ffffffff810a099a>] warn_slowpath_null+0x1a/0x20 [ 0.026961] [<ffffffff81d8c395>] __early_ioremap+0x102/0x1bb [ 0.026962] [<ffffffff81d8c602>] early_memremap+0x13/0x15 [ 0.026964] [<ffffffff81d78361>] efi_bgrt_init+0x162/0x1ad [ 0.026966] [<ffffffff81d778ec>] efi_late_init+0x9/0xb [ 0.026968] [<ffffffff81d58ff5>] start_kernel+0x46f/0x49f [ 0.026970] [<ffffffff81d58120>] ? early_idt_handler_array+0x120/0x120 [ 0.026972] [<ffffffff81d58339>] x86_64_start_reservations+0x2a/0x2c [ 0.026974] [<ffffffff81d58485>] x86_64_start_kernel+0x14a/0x16d [ 0.026977] ---[ end trace f9b3812eb8e24c58 ]--- [ 0.026978] efi_bgrt: Ignoring BGRT: failed to map image memory early_memremap() has an upper limit on the size of mapping it can handle which is ~200KB. Clearly the BGRT image on Môshe's machine is much larger than that. There's actually no reason to restrict ourselves to using the early_* version of memremap() - the ACPI BGRT driver is invoked late enough in boot that we can use the standard version, with the benefit that the late version allows mappings of arbitrary size.
